c#开发单机的数据库程序,写好之后怎么把程序和数据库文件打包给用户使用?
vs2005+sqlserver2005比如在连接数据库的时候怎么设置啊,最好有实例,谢谢1、用户没有装sqlserver怎么办,我程序和mdf文件打包可以吗?难道要用户...
vs2005 + sql server 2005
比如在连接数据库的时候怎么设置啊,最好有实例,谢谢 1、用户没有装sql server怎么办,我程序和mdf文件打包可以吗?难道要用户安装sqlserver吗?
2、在vs2005和sqlserver2005开发好的程序,怎么生成一个傻瓜安装文件发布给用户? 要连带数据库哦!!!可以注册\更新之类的。 展开
比如在连接数据库的时候怎么设置啊,最好有实例,谢谢 1、用户没有装sql server怎么办,我程序和mdf文件打包可以吗?难道要用户安装sqlserver吗?
2、在vs2005和sqlserver2005开发好的程序,怎么生成一个傻瓜安装文件发布给用户? 要连带数据库哦!!!可以注册\更新之类的。 展开
2013-11-19
展开全部
你可以使用SQL Server 2005 Express版本,发布的时候连着SQL Server 2005 Express一起发布。Express有60多兆,让用户先装Express再装你的软件。数据库的话就直接是数据库生成的那两个文件就行。改下连接字符串,改为链接SQL Server 2005 Express的就行。SQL Server 2005的链接字符串是:Server=.\SQLExpress;AttachDbFilename=|DataDirectory|数据库文件名.mdf;Database=数据库名称;Trusted_Connection=Yes;
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-11-19
展开全部
你可以使用compact版本的数据库,SDB就可以不用安装Express了,或者用MDB也可以,单机程序不一定要用SQL。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-11-19
展开全部
1、用户当然要装sql server,否则数据库里的键、索引、约束等等谁来维护?2、mdf文件可以分离打包(数据库分离),但是更建议将数据库以SQL文档或者是XML文档的形式输出,具体做法看一下联机文档就可以了,简单得很。3、自己写一个数据初始化的小程序打进安装包里,基本安装后执行一下就可以了。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询